You can find the average speed of an object if you know the distance travelled and the time it took. The formula for speed is speed = distance ÷ time. To work out what the units are for speed ...

The most common units of speed are metres per second (m/s), kilometres per hour (km/h) and miles per hour (mph). In a typical car journey the speed of the car will change.
